====== Mock Test #1 ====== This mock test is designed to help you assess your readiness for the **Microsoft AI-900: Azure AI Fundamentals** exam. It covers key topics and will give you an idea of the types of questions you might encounter. ===== 🧠 Sample Questions ===== **1. What is Artificial Intelligence?** A. The ability of a machine to perform tasks that would normally require human intelligence. B. A computer system that simulates human emotions. C. A software system that automates routine tasks. D. The study of robotics and automation. **2. Which of the following is an example of supervised learning?** A. Clustering customers based on buying behavior. B. Predicting housing prices using labeled historical data. C. Playing a game and learning from trial and error. D. Detecting anomalies in a time series dataset. **3. Which Azure service is used to build conversational bots with minimal code?** A. Azure Bot Service B. Azure Cognitive Services C. Azure Machine Learning Studio D. LUIS (Language Understanding Intelligent Service) **4. What does AutoML in Azure do?** A. Automatically generates data pipelines. B. Builds machine learning models based on pre-defined templates. C. Selects the best algorithm and hyperparameters for your model. D. Creates chatbots from scratch. **5. Which of the following is a principle of Responsible AI?** A. Fairness B. Profitability C. Speed D. Complexity ===== 📝 Answer Key ===== 1. A 2. B 3. A 4. C 5. A ====== Tips and Strategies for the AI-900 Exam ====== The **Microsoft AI-900: Azure AI Fundamentals** exam is designed to test your understanding of core AI concepts and how they are applied using Azure services. Here are some strategies to help you prepare and succeed. ===== 📚 Study Tips ===== **1. Understand the Exam Domains** The exam is divided into several domains, each with specific skills that will be tested: * **AI Fundamentals (15-20%)** Learn about what AI is, its different types, and the key components like machine learning and natural language processing. * **Azure AI Services (30-35%)** Focus on Cognitive Services, machine learning, and conversational AI tools such as LUIS and Azure Bot Service. * **Azure Machine Learning (20-25%)** Be familiar with the Azure ML Studio, AutoML, and model deployment processes. * **Responsible AI (15-20%)** Know Microsoft’s principles of Responsible AI and how to apply them in real-world scenarios. **2. Use Microsoft Learn** * Microsoft Learn provides a free, structured learning path for the AI-900. Make sure to go through all the modules, as the exam is closely tied to this material. * The learning paths cover both theoretical knowledge and practical applications within the Azure platform, which is key for passing the exam. **3. Hands-On Practice** * Use the **Azure free tier** or trial account to get hands-on experience with the tools. Try building models, using Cognitive Services, and deploying simple AI solutions. * Practice using **Azure ML Studio**, **LUIS**, and the **Azure Bot Service** to become comfortable with the interfaces and processes. **4. Take Practice Tests** * Practice tests are a great way to simulate the exam environment. They help you assess your understanding of the topics and improve your test-taking strategy. * Review your answers to practice questions and focus on areas where you scored poorly.
